Frequently Asked Questions about Chatham-Kent

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Chatham-Kent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Chatham-Kent ranges from C$1,250 to C$1,499 with an average monthly rent of C$1,382.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Chatham-Kent c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Chatham-Kent range from C$1,350 to C$1,799.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is C$1,576.
